Voice Not Coming Out Dream Meaning: Hidden Emotions, Communication Difficulties, and the Need for Self-Expression

Inability to Communicate

When you dream of your voice not coming out, it symbolizes your inability to communicate your thoughts and feelings. This can be due to various reasons such as fear, anxiety, or insecurity. It can also indicate that you are feeling unheard or misunderstood in your waking life.

This dream may be telling you that you need to work on your communication skills or that you need to find other ways to express yourself. It may also be a sign that you need to set boundaries and learn to say no when you need to.

If you are struggling with your ability to communicate, there are a few things you can do to improve it. First, try to identify the root of your problem. What is it that is making you afraid or anxious to speak up? Once you know what the problem is, you can start to work on it.

There are many resources available to help you improve your communication skills. You can take a class, read books, or find online resources. You can also practice communicating with friends and family members. The more you practice, the better you will become at it.

If you are feeling unheard or misunderstood, it is important to talk to someone who can help you. This could be a friend, family member, therapist, or other trusted individual. Talking about your feelings can help you to process them and to come up with solutions to your problems.

Remember, you are not alone. Many people struggle with their ability to communicate. With effort and practice, you can improve your communication skills and learn to express yourself more effectively.

Cultural and Historical Symbolism of Voiceless Dreams

Dreams of stifled vocalization have a long-standing presence in various cultures and historical contexts:

  • Ancient Egypt: In ancient Egyptian dream lore, the inability to speak could represent feelings of powerlessness or oppression.

  • Classical Greece and Rome: Greek and Roman dream dictionaries often equated the failure to speak with being silenced in waking life, either by authority figures or social norms.

  • Medieval Europe: During the Middle Ages, a dream of a stifled voice was sometimes interpreted as a sign of witchcraft or demonic influence.

  • Native American Traditions: In certain Native American cultures, the inability to speak in dreams could be seen as a sign of being surrounded by spirits or being on the brink of a significant life change.

  • Modern Psychology: In contemporary psychological interpretations, dreams of voicelessness often reflect feelings of frustration, anxiety, or a lack of agency in the dreamer's waking life.

The Common Thread of Expression and Communication: Despite cultural and historical differences, the recurring theme of stifled communication in dreams hints at the universal human need to express ourselves and be heard.
